Overview

The WEG 01018ET3HCT215TF1-W2 is a robust 10 HP, 4-pole integral horsepower motor engineered for demanding industrial environments, specifically designed for vertical cooling tower fan applications. This motor exemplifies WEG's commitment to delivering reliable and durable power solutions, ensuring consistent performance even under challenging operational conditions. Its construction prioritizes longevity and resistance to corrosive elements commonly found in cooling tower systems. Key features of this WEG motor include a stainless steel shaft, providing superior corrosion resistance and mechanical strength, crucial for extended service life in moist and chemically exposed settings. The motor boasts an epoxy-coated finish, offering an additional layer of protection against environmental degradation. Furthermore, it is equipped with sealed bearings, designed to prevent ingress of moisture and contaminants, thereby maintaining optimal bearing performance and reducing the need for frequent maintenance. This sealed construction is paramount for applications where continuous exposure to moisture and chemicals is a certainty. What is WEG's warranty policy?

WEG offers an 18-month standard warranty for automation products, covering defects in workmanship and materials. The warranty requires proper transportation, handling, storage, and installation within specified environmental conditions. Repairs must be performed by authorized WEG service, and the warranty is limited to the replacement or repair of the product itself, excluding consequential damages. Extended warranty options are available, including purchasing additional coverage at 2.5% of the product's selling price per year, up to 4 additional years.

What environmental ratings do WEG products have?

WEG products feature multiple environmental ratings and protection classes. They offer Protection Class 3C2 as a standard coating and Protection Class 3C3 as an optional extra coating, both compliant with IEC 60721-3-3. Environmental specifications include air relative humidity from 5% to 95% non-condensing, altitude ratings up to 1,000m standard (with current derating above that), and Pollution Degree 2 classification with non-conductive pollution requirements.

What accessories are available for WEG products?

WEG offers a comprehensive range of accessories across multiple product lines. For variable frequency drives like the CFW900, accessories include I/O expansion modules, communication modules, encoder modules, temperature transducer modules, relay output modules, and HMI accessories. These accessories expand communication capabilities, input/output functions, and application flexibility. Most accessories are interchangeable between drive frames and can be installed in backplane slots, with communication network accessories limited to one per variable speed drive.
